TTLB Blogosphere Ecosystem: FAQ

What exactly is the TTLB Blogosphere Ecosystem?

The TTLB Blogosphere Ecosystem is an application which scans weblogs once daily and generates a list of weblogs ranked by the number of incoming links they receive from other weblogs on the list.

What links does the TTLB Ecosystem count?

All links from a scanned weblog to any other weblog (i.e., links from a weblog to itself are ignored). This includes links within posts, and 'permanent' links in a weblog's blogroll.

Does the TTLB Ecosystem scan all pages of a weblog?

No, only the front page.

Does the TTLB Ecosystem handle Blogrolling.com blogrolls?

Yes. Even if you are using the Javascript implementation of Blogrolling.com, the Ecosystem is designed to retrieve your blogroll when it scans your weblog.
